Many Afrezza users have reported rapid drops in A1c


Yeah, but in the only clinical trials that compared Afrezza to rapid acting insulins, Afrezza did no such thing.

Straight from the label:

Absolute HgA1c reduction:
Afrezza : 0.21
Rapid I : 0.40

% of patients reducing by 7% or more:
Affreza: 13.8%
Rapid I: 27.1%

And there is your problem. Tweets do not counter clinical trial data.

Afrezza avoids the needle, for sure.But is it better?

It has a faster/narrower spike. BUT, to take advantage of this, the user need to know how to use it.

Perhaps a few users have got it down, and do better. But that does not work for the masses.

MNKD really needs to figure out how to work with the new electronic glucose monitors to solve this issue.
